H&M – H&M is a Swedish multinational clothing retailer brand. This organisation was
established in the year of 1947 by Erling Persson. Hennes and Maurtiz is a fast fashion for men,
women and teenagers. This company operate their 4500 stores in approx. 62 countries. Firm has
around 1,32,000 employees who provide their effective and quality services to target customers.
Firm uses different promotion techniques by online services to operate effectively in different
countries (Bingham and Main, 2010). Through this they build large number of customers with
their brand and its products. H&M adopt several changes in their business policies and procedure
to get connected with several customers and grabbing different opportunities.
